I really like the 100pt Raptor Chariot in Special, its a bit of a bargain imo. Overall I feel like the Manticore is the best character mount though, especially with Beastmaster. I still am not sure about the Pegasus. On one hand its fairly cheap and flexible, on the other its not nearly as tough as it used to be with the loss of the SDC. The chariot mount seems a bit too expensive to me, I prefer mounting a character on the Divine Altar in that pricerange.
